No move to withdraw security from separatists for now
9/7/2016 10:44:14 PM

Early Times Report

JAMMU, Sept 7: Though a huge amount over Rs 500 crore is being spent on the security of separatist leaders in Valley, there is no move to withdraw the security of the separatist leaders and the speculations made in this regard were unfounded.
According to official sources there is no move to withdraw the security of the separatist leaders including Hurriyat hardliner Syed Ali Shah Geelani the mastermind of present unrest in Kashmir. The withdrawal of security to the separatist leaders will amount to inviting more trouble which the government is not going to do at this juncture, sources added.
Sources said acting tough against the separatists and Hurriyat leadership which is behind the present unrest in the Valley, does not mean the withdrawal of the security as this way government will invite more trouble for itself. However, the Government may crack down on the separatists as well as militants and also freeze their bank accounts and unearth the source which is funding the separatist movement in the Valley, sources said.
Sources said the Government is seriously pondering over taking some harsh steps to counter the present unrest in the Valley by taking stern action against the separatist leadership and the investigations against the separatists as well as son of Hurriyat hardliner Syed Ali Shah Geelani will continue.
Sources said withdrawing of security from separatists will provide a chance to Pakistan to make any mischief to aggravate the situation further in Kashmir. However it is committed to act tough against the separatists and terrorists and a concrete policy in this regard is being devised by the Union Government, sources added.
Sources said to take the opposition leaders into confidence after holding a meeting of APD at Union Capital today the Centre will give practical shape to its new strategy on Kashmir within a day or two. While it will show leniency towards the youth and common man and take extra measures to ensure that there should not be any more loss of life and find out possibilities of restoring normalcy by holding talks with anyone who means in Kashmir at the same time it will not hesitate in acting tough against the separatist leadership and terrorists by launching a major crackdown on them.
Rubbishing the idea of withdrawal of privileges of separatist leaders, CPI (M) leader and M P
D Raja today told reporters in Union Capital after the APD meeting. "Who has told you this? Has any statement come from government in this regard or has Union Home Minister made an announcement about the same?" raja questioned.
When his attention was drawn by a reporter about the media reports Raja said that media reports were based on speculations, they were wrong. "The report can only be authenticated when it comes from government side and the Home Minster has not said anything about it", he added.
